Mississippi College Debaters Excel


Mississippi College debaters excelled in the Lumberjack Showdown Debate Tournament in Texas.

MC senior Chase Porter of Picayune stayed on top of his game as one of the South's premier debaters. He won the varsity division of the tournament held Nov. 8-9 at Stephen F. Austin State University in Nacogdoches.

"Chase's accomplishments in this tournament are truly outstanding," said MC communication professor Merle Ziegler, the MC debate team coach. "Through skill and determination he was able to defeat every debater he faced in the elimination rounds to finally win the varsity division of the tournament."

Porter, who placed as high as 5th in the national debate tournament last year, is in his final year of competitive debate. He served as vice president of the MC Student Government Association in 2007-2008.

There were a total of 60 debaters entered from a dozen universities. Besides MC, Louisiana College, Union University, Louisiana State University, Sam Houston State University, Harding University, the College of Southern Idaho, East Texas Baptist and the University of Central Arkansas were among others competing.
